Hannah Miller is from Irmo, South Carolina where she grew up playing soccer and dancing before switching to basketball. She became a certified personal trainer in 2016 where she trained individuals to get through college before graduating with her Bachelor of Science degree in Exercise Science (‘19) from the University of South Carolina. Hannah followed her family to Austin, Texas graduating where she began to build her own online coaching business. In 2021, she went back to school to earn her Master degree in Athletic Training (‘23) at Texas State University. While at Texas State, she had the opportunity to work with football, track and field, and volleyball at the university, as well as, interning with the Austin Gilgronis Major League Rugby team. In her free time, Hannah enjoys going to the dog park with her dog Libby, getting a good workout in at the gym or outside, and going country dancing.
Ann-Marie is from La Coste, Texas and grew up playing softball and participating in marching band as a snare drum. After high school she attended The University of Texas at Austin and got her Bachelor's in Athletic Training ('19) where she worked with football, men's swimming and diving, men's tennis, girls soccer, baseball, and softball. From 2020-2022 she worked in California at a high school where she began their athletic training student aide program, then moved back to the Austin area to be closer to family. She has been married since 2020 and has two children, one boy and one girl. In her free time she enjoys baking and going on a rare date night to try new restaurants.
